Beginning his professional trajectory with an unexpected 2007 collaboration with Gorillaz at the Théâtre du Châtelet, Henri Deléger has evolved into a performer of considerable artistic range, equally commanding in contemporary orchestral work and the demanding avant-garde operatic repertoire. Since 2018, he has established himself as a principal interpreter of Karlheinz Stockhausen's monumental operas, consistently performing the role of Michaël with the ensemble Le Balcon in *Donnerstag aus Licht* and *Samstag aus Licht*. Complementing his performance career, Deléger has pursued formal pedagogical training, positioning himself as both virtuosic interpreter and mentor.
Principal trumpet performer in Karlheinz Stockhausen's *Donnerstag aus Licht* and *Samstag aus Licht* with ensemble Le Balcon (2018–present)
Université Paris-Sorbonne (Musicology); Conservatoire National Supérieur de Musique de Paris (Master's in Performance, 2010); Zürcher Hochschule der Künste; Conservatoire National Supérieur de Musique de Lyon (Master's in Pedagogy, 2014)
